Moonknight (Disney Plus): I’m actually super pumped for this, I’m a die-hard Batman fan and Moonknight is pretty much Marvel’s version of Batman, so yeah I’m hyped for this one. This series will follow Steven Grant and mercenary Marc Spector (who is actually the same person with dual personalities) as they investigate the mysteries of the Egyptian gods. Ms. Marvel (Disney Plus) – I was first introduced to Ms. Kamala Khan back in 2014, not too long after she first launched and I was instantly hooked. After discovering that she has shapeshifting abilities, Kamala assumes the mantle of Ms. Marvel from her idol Carol Danvers after Danvers becomes Captain Marvel. I loved Kamala’s personality in the comics so I can’t wait to see what they will do with her for this series. This series will also serve as a set-up for the film The Marvels – y’all know I’m patiently waiting to see my girl Monica Rambeau back in action. OKAY!
